How to Make a Simple Paper Fan

Black and white folded fan.

A simple Paper Fan

To make a fan, you will need the following materials:

  • Construction paper, 11" x 8 1/2"
  • Stapler

Decorate both sides of a piece of the 11 x 8 1/2-inch construction paper. Beginning at the short side, fold over and under, making 3/4 inch wide strips, down length of the paper.


Hold one end of the folded paper firmly and staple several times and on both sides. Holding the stapled end, flip wrist rapidly so that the fan creates a "wind."
